Chassis, Suspension, Brakes & Wheels

FrametypeTubular chrome-molibdenum steel
FrontbrakesDouble disc. Brembo, 4-pistons, 4-pads with radial Brembo calipers
Frontbrakesdiameter320 mm (12.6 inches)
Frontsuspension50mm Marzocchi forks
Fronttyre120/70-17
Frontwheeltravel165 mm (6.5 inches)
RearbrakesSingle disc. 2-pistons,
Rearbrakesdiameter220 mm (8.7 inches)
RearsuspensionMonoshock, fully adjustable
Reartyre180/55-17
Rearwheeltravel120 mm (4.7 inches)
WheelsForged Alluminium

Engine & Transmission

Borexstroke98.0 x 71.5 mm (3.9 x 2.8 inches)
ClutchDry multidisc
Compression10.5:1
CoolingsystemOil & air
Displacement1078.00 ccm (65.78 cubic inches)
EmissiondetailsEuro 3
EnginedetailsV2, four-stroke
EnginetypeDucati 1100DS engine. L-twin.
FuelsystemInjection. Magneti Marelli-45mm throttle body
Gearbox6-speed
IgnitionWalbro
LubricationsystemWet sump
Power98.00 HP (71.5 kW)) @ 7750 RPM
Topspeed220.0 km/h (136.7 mph)
Torque105.00 Nm (10.7 kgf-m or 77.4 ft.lbs) @ 5500 RPM
TransmissiontypefinaldriveChain
Valvespercylinder2

Other Specifications

ColoroptionsRed/white/green
CommentsItalian brand.
StarterElectric

Physical Measures & Capacities

Dryweight168.0 kg (370.4 pounds)
Fuelcapacity14.00 litres (3.70 gallons)
Overallheight1,330 mm (52.4 inches)
Overalllength2,045 mm (80.5 inches)
Overallwidth850 mm (33.5 inches)
Powerweightratio0.5833 HP/kg
Seatheight810 mm (31.9 inches) If adjustable, lowest setting.

Engine Performance and Riding Characteristics

At the heart of the DB10 rd lies a potent 1,078 cc V2, four-stroke engine that churns out a robust 98 horsepower at 7,750 RPM and a torque figure of 105 Nm at 5,500 RPM. This powertrain is finely tuned to provide not just raw speed but also an engaging riding experience, allowing riders to reach a top speed of 220 km/h (136.7 mph) with confidence. The engine's 10.5:1 compression ratio and precise fuel injection system, featuring a Magneti Marelli 45mm throttle body, ensure crisp throttle response and impressive acceleration. Coupled with a 6-speed gearbox and a dry multidisc clutch, the DB10 rd is designed for both spirited rides and everyday commuting, making it a versatile choice for the discerning motorcyclist.

Key Features and Technology

The Bimota DB10 rd is more than just a powerful engine; it's a technological marvel packed with features that enhance both performance and comfort. The robust tubular chrome-molybdenum steel frame not only contributes to the bike's structural integrity but also aids in achieving a lightweight design, tipping the scales at just 168 kg (370.4 lbs). The fully adjustable Monoshock rear suspension and 50mm Marzocchi front forks provide excellent handling and stability, ensuring that the bike remains composed even when pushed to its limits. The high-performance Brembo braking system, with dual 320 mm front discs and a single 220 mm rear disc, offers exceptional stopping power and feedback, making every ride an exhilarating adventure.

Pros and Cons of the Bimota DB10 rd

Pros:

  1. Exceptional Performance: The powerful V2 engine delivers impressive horsepower and torque, ensuring thrilling acceleration and top speed.
  2. Lightweight and Agile: At 168 kg, the DB10 rd is nimble and easy to handle, making it ideal for both urban environments and twisty roads.
  3. Superior Braking System: With high-quality Brembo brakes, riders can expect responsive and reliable stopping power in various conditions.

Cons:

  1. Limited Fuel Capacity: With a 14-liter tank, the DB10 rd may require more frequent stops during long rides.
  2. Seat Height: At 810 mm, it may not be suitable for shorter riders without modifications, potentially limiting its accessibility.
  3. Price Point: As a premium Italian brand, the Bimota DB10 rd comes with a higher price tag, which may deter some potential buyers.
